The flowing and changing of the river symbolizes the progression of Huck and Jim’s adventure. It also symbolizes

Huck’s growth and his realization of his mistakes and how he can turn them into better situations. In the end, both of the runaways’ dreams come true. Jim gained freedom for himself and his family and Huck gained knowledge, and freedom from his Pap forever...
